" 2.5 stars. There's nothing phenomenal about the writing style and the book didn't teach me anything new, per se; the best advice came from the quotes that Dyer draws upon from writers like Tolstoy, Thoreau, Gandhi, etc. The book also had a bit too much religiosity to it for my taste. It was a good end of the night book, however, to ease my mind and remind me of the need to slow down and refocus my thoughts, and it contained some important reminders about the powers of meditation and positive thinking.
